sqlserver中类似于GREATEST()的函数

动态 未结 0 125
小小草
小小草 LV1 2023年9月23日 23:20 发表
在 SQL Server 中,没有类似于 MySQL 中的 GREATEST() 函数。但是,您可以使用 CASE 表达式来模拟此函数。 例如,假设您有三个列 a、b 和 c,并且您想要找到它们中的最大值。您可以使用以下查询: ``` SELECT CASE WHEN a >= b AND a >= c THEN a WHEN b >= a AND b >= c THEN b ELSE c END AS max_value FROM your_table; ``` 这将返回一个名为 max_value 的列,其中包含 a、b 和 c 列中的最大值。
收藏(0)  分享
相关标签: 智能问答
问题没解决?让AI助手帮你作答 AI助手
0个回复
  • 消灭零回复